Meeting notes — Checkout load test (Cartwheel flow), Tuesday sync.

- Ran 5k concurrent sessions against staging; payment step held at p95 of 900ms.
- Inventory lock service degraded above 6k; retry storm observed, fix scheduled.
- Support impact: expect brief checkout slowness during next week's production test window, Tuesday 02:00–04:00.
- Canned response drafted; see the support macros page.
- Escalations during the test window go to the engineer running it.

named custodian: Oliath Ralax

The LiftSim elevator-dispatch simulator on the Hallowick cluster is running with cabin-acceleration and door-dwell values that no longer match the committed manifest. Someone hot-patched staging during the Q3 throughput test and the change was never reverted. Dispatch latency numbers from last night's run are therefore not comparable to the baseline. Please review the diff before I force-sync; I want a second pair of eyes on the lobby-priority weighting. The current effective values on staging are as follows.

config for kafof-bawef:
holath:
  log_level: debug
  metrics_host: metrics.holath.qorvelsys.internal
  pin: 2191
  pool_size: 32

## v2.14.0 — Splitwire Assignment Service

New team members, note this carefully: bucket hashing now uses the experiment salt plus unit ID, fixing the drift that caused users to flip variants mid-experiment. Existing assignments are preserved via the legacy lookup table until Q3. Rollout is gated behind the `stable_buckets` flag. Questions about this change should go to the release owner named below.

account owner for fajep-yagef: Kasix Eliiel

## Authentication

Scanlark's barcode scanner bridge requires a service account per station. Scans post to the intake endpoint; unauthenticated requests are dropped, not queued. Rotate credentials quarterly — the bridge caches them for 24h, so plan rotations before a shift, not during. For the eng sync demo environment, all stations share one credential. Demo requests must include the bearer token below.

login token, bagug-kafop: eyJhbGciOiJIUzI1NiIsInR5cCI6IkpXVCJ9.eyJzdWIiOiIcMLov2In0.Z5RLDIfp